PROGRAM OVERVIEW
 
Prepare for a career in avionics with practical, hands-on training focused on aircraft electrical and avionics systems. Develop the technical skills used in today’s aviation industry through a combination of theory and hands-on training.
 
WHAT YOU’LL LEARN
 
AVIATION THEORY
• Aircraft components and terminology
• Aircraft systems and basic operation
• Flight instruments and avionics systems
• Navigation and communication fundamentals
• Aviation safety and industry practices
 
ELECTRONICS FUNDAMENTALS
• Basic electricity and electronics
• AC and DC circuits
• Electronic components and their functions
• Electrical measurements and test equipment
• Circuit analysis and troubleshooting fundamentals
 
HANDS-ON AVIONICS TRAINING
• Read and interpret wiring diagrams and electrical schematics
• Aircraft wiring and wire harness fabrication
• Connector installation, termination, and inspection
• Avionics installation and system integration
• Navigation and communication systems
• Testing, inspection, and troubleshooting procedures
• Use of industry-standard avionics tools and test equipment
 
PROGRAM LENGTH: 6 Months
 
TRAINING: Theory + Hands-On Training
 
CERTIFICATIONS & LICENSES: NCATT Certification & FCC Licenses

PROGRAM OVERVIEW
 
Build practical skills in industrial electronics and automation systems used in modern manufacturing and automated environments. This program combines electronics fundamentals with hands-on training in industrial controls, electrical systems, PLCs, sensors, motors, and automation technology.
 
WHAT YOU’LL LEARN
 
ELECTRONICS FUNDAMENTALS
• Basic electricity and electronics
• AC and DC circuits
• Electronic components and their functions
• Electrical measurements and test equipment
• Reading electrical schematics and wiring diagrams
• Circuit analysis and troubleshooting
 
INDUSTRIAL ELECTRONICS
• Industrial electrical systems and components
• Motors, relays, contactors, and control circuits
• Sensors and industrial control devices
• Electrical wiring and connections
• Testing and troubleshooting industrial systems
 
AUTOMATION & CONTROLS
• Programmable Logic Controllers (PLCs) & Programming Fundamentals
• Human-Machine Interfaces (HMIs)
• Automated control systems
• Industrial system troubleshooting
• Hands-on automation applications
 
PROGRAM LENGTH: 6 Months
 
TRAINING: Electronics Fundamentals + Industrial Electronics + Hands-On Automation Training
 
CERTIFICATIONS: Industrial Electronics

PROGRAM OVERVIEW
 
Build a strong foundation in electronics through focused training in electrical theory, electronic components, circuits, test equipment, soldering, troubleshooting, and technical documentation. This program is designed for students who want practical electronics knowledge and preparation for an industry-recognized electronics certification.
 
WHAT YOU’LL LEARN
 
ELECTRICAL & ELECTRONICS FUNDAMENTALS
• Basic electricity and electronics
• AC and DC circuits
• Electronic components and their functions
• Circuit analysis and troubleshooting
• Electrical measurements and test equipment
 
PRACTICAL ELECTRONICS SKILLS
• Reading schematics and wiring diagrams
• Soldering and component installation
• Testing electronic circuits and components
• Use of multimeters and electronic test equipment
• Basic troubleshooting procedures
 
TECHNICAL KNOWLEDGE
• Analog and digital electronics fundamentals
• Electronic safety practices
• Technical documentation and diagrams
• Basic communication and electronic systems concepts
 
PROGRAM LENGTH: 2 Months
 
TRAINING: Electronics Fundamentals + Practical Hands-On Training
 
CERTIFICATION: ETA Certified Electronics Technician Associate (CETa)
